Midfielder out for home clash

Middlesbrough midfielder Rhys Williams is suspended for the home game with Reading after being dismissed in midweek.


This suspension adds to Gordon Strachan's worries as his list of injured players continues to grow.

Defender Kyle Naughton picked up a knee problem at Pride Park in midweek and is doubtful for the game tomorrow and the match will also come too soon for Emanuel Pogatetz, whose knee injury is on the mend.

Add these to the list of Willo Flood, Jeremie Aliadiere, Tony McMahon, Seb Hines and Matthew Bates who are all out with a variety of problems, which leaves the manager's options limited for the clash against in-form Reading.
